How to Access YouTube on Your LG Smart TV

Following are the most common methods to watch YouTube on your LG Smart TV.

1. Via Pre-installed Apps

Most LG Smart TVs come with YouTube pre-installed. If your device has it, getting started is straightforward:

Steps to Access Pre-installed YouTube

  1. Turn on your LG Smart TV and press the Home button on your remote.
  2. Navigate to the Apps section on your home screen.
  3. Scroll to find the YouTube app icon and select it.
  4. The YouTube app will open, allowing you to explore videos and channels.

2. Installing YouTube From LG Content Store

In case your LG Smart TV does not have YouTube installed, you can easily download it from the LG Content Store.

Steps to Download YouTube

  1. Power on your LG Smart TV and press the Home button.
  2. Go to the LG Content Store.
  3. Select the Search option located in the top-right corner.
  4. Type in YouTube and search.
  5. Once you find the app, click on it, then select Install.
  6. After installation, return to the home screen where the YouTube app should now be visible.

Creating and Signing into Your Account

To enjoy personalized recommendations, playlists, and subscriptions, consider signing into your existing YouTube account:

Steps to Sign In

  1. Open the YouTube app on your LG Smart TV.
  2. Select the Sign In button, usually found in the left menu.
  3. A code will be displayed on your TV screen.
  4. Using a smartphone or computer, navigate to www.youtube.com/activate.
  5. Enter the displayed code and follow the prompts to complete signing in.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Despite advancements in technology, users may encounter issues while accessing YouTube. Here are some common problems and their solutions.

1. YouTube Not Opening

If you’re unable to open YouTube, try the following troubleshooting steps:

Steps to Resolve YouTube App Issues

  • Restart Your TV: Turn your LG Smart TV off and on again, which may resolve minor glitches.
  • Check for Updates: Navigate to Settings, then select All Settings > General > About This TV to check for software updates.

2. Buffering or Slow Loading

Experiencing buffering issues can be frustrating. Here’s how to tackle slow loading times:

Steps to Improve Streaming

  • Check Your Internet Connection: Ensure your Wi-Fi is working properly. Try using a wired connection for better stability.
  • Reduce Other Network Traffic: Disconnect additional devices that might be consuming bandwidth.

Alternative Methods to Get YouTube on LG Smart TV

If you face continuous issues with the YouTube app, or if your LG TV lacks smart features, consider these alternatives to access YouTube content.

Using Screen Mirroring

Screen mirroring allows you to display content from your mobile device directly to your TV screen.

Steps to Enable Screen Mirroring

  1. Ensure your mobile device and LG Smart TV are connected to the same Wi-Fi network.
  2. On your LG Smart TV, navigate to the screen mirroring option in the settings.
  3. On your mobile device, activate the screen mirroring option, which varies by OS and model.
  4. Select your LG Smart TV from the list of devices to connect.

Using HDMI Cable

Another straightforward method is using an HDMI cable to connect your laptop or desktop to the TV.

Steps to Use HDMI Cable

  1. Connect one end of the HDMI cable to your computer and the other to an available HDMI port on your LG Smart TV.
  2. Switch the input source on your TV to the corresponding HDMI port.
  3. Open YouTube on your computer, and it will display on your TV screen.

1. How do I download the YouTube app on my LG Smart TV?

To download the YouTube app on your LG Smart TV, first, turn on your TV and ensure that it’s connected to the internet. Navigate to the LG Content Store by pressing the “Home” button on your remote and selecting the “LG Content Store” icon. Once you’re in the store, use the search function to type “YouTube” and find the YouTube app in the results.

After locating the app, click on it to open the detailed view, where you will see the option to download and install the app. Click the “Install” button, and the app will begin downloading. Once installed, you can return to your home screen to find the YouTube app icon and start enjoying your favorite videos.

2. Why isn’t the YouTube app appearing on my LG Smart TV?

If the YouTube app is not appearing on your LG Smart TV, it could be due to a few different reasons. First, ensure that your TV model supports the YouTube app, as some older models may not have it available for download. Additionally, if your TV’s software is outdated, the app may not show up in the LG Content Store.

To resolve this issue, check for any available software updates by going to the settings menu and selecting “About This TV,” then “Check for Updates.” If an update is available, download and install it. Once your TV has the latest software, return to the LG Content Store to search for and install the YouTube app.

3. Can I watch YouTube without the app on my LG Smart TV?

Yes, you can watch YouTube without the app on your LG Smart TV using the built-in web browser. To do this, press the “Home” button on your remote and navigate to the web browser icon. Open the browser and enter the URL for YouTube (www.youtube.com) in the address bar, and you’ll be directed to the website.

While watching YouTube through the web browser, you’ll have access to most of the features available on the app. However, keep in mind that the experience may not be as smooth as using the dedicated app, as it might lack some functionalities and optimizations that enhance video playback and navigation.

4. How do I cast YouTube to my LG Smart TV?

To cast YouTube to your LG Smart TV, make sure both your TV and casting device (like a smartphone or tablet) are connected to the same Wi-Fi network. Open the YouTube app on your mobile device and find the video you want to watch. Look for the “Cast” icon, which resembles a rectangle with a Wi-Fi symbol, usually located in the upper right corner of the app.

Tap on the “Cast” icon, and you should see a list of available devices. Select your LG Smart TV from the list, and your video will start playing on the TV screen. This method allows you to control the video playback from your mobile device while enjoying it on the bigger screen.

5. Why is the YouTube app not working properly on my LG Smart TV?

If the YouTube app is not working properly on your LG Smart TV, several factors could be at play. First, check your internet connection to ensure it is stable and fast enough for streaming. Poor connectivity can lead to buffering issues or make the app unresponsive.

Another potential issue may be outdated app software. Make sure you have the latest version of the YouTube app installed. To update the app, head to the LG Content Store and check for updates. If the problem persists, consider resetting the app to its factory settings or restarting your TV to resolve any temporary glitches.

6. How can I sign out of the YouTube app on my LG Smart TV?

To sign out of the YouTube app on your LG Smart TV, start by launching the app from your home screen. Once inside the app, navigate to the left-hand menu by pressing the left arrow button on your remote. Scroll down to find the “Settings” option and select it to open the settings menu.

Inside the settings menu, look for the “Sign Out” option. Once you locate it, select it, and confirm your choice to sign out. After completing this process, you will need to sign in again if you wish to access your personalized account features in the future.

7. What should I do if I can’t find the YouTube app in my country?

If you can’t find the YouTube app available for download on your LG Smart TV in your country, it could be due to regional restrictions or licensing issues. One potential workaround is to use a VPN (Virtual Private Network) that allows you to change your location to a supported country where the app is available.

However, using a VPN may not always be in line with the Terms of Service for certain apps, and can sometimes lead to connectivity issues. Another option is to access YouTube through the web browser on your TV, as this method may not be subject to the same regional restrictions as the app itself.
